Horse Running Sound Is Called. What sounds do horses make when they are running? Horses are not the most vocal animals, but they do use sounds in order to communicate with humans and with each other. How to interpret horse sounds and identify their meaning. When horses are galloping, their hoofbeats make a recognizable sound. Some horses may whinny while galloping, but vocalizations are not typical when horses are exerting themselves under saddle. Many horses also squeal while they are running wild, bucking or fighting.
